description | Transcripts of Hungarian national radio programs produced by the Hungarian Monitoring Unit of Radio Free Europe/Radio Liberty.
A magyar országos rádióadók műsorainak a Szabad Európa Rádió/Szabadság Rádió Magyar Monitoring Osztálya által készített átiratai.
International Politics: <br/>- European colloquium roundtable <br/>- Malév Hungarian Airlines takes part in an aid shipment to Kuwait <br/>- UN Security Council on tightening the embargo against Iraq <br/>- US reduces the size of its armed forces stationed abroad <br/>- Moscow stock exchange opens <br/><br/>Domestic Affairs: <br/>- Thatcher visits Budapest <br/>- Otto Habsburg in talks in Budapest <br/>- József Antall meets Radio Free Europe supervisory board <br/>- Hungarian education in Romania
